# Env Vars: Planner Regression Mitigation

After the query planner regression in Corvid DB 9.3, Fernwell's release builds must pin the legacy planner until the patched build ships. Set `CORVID_PLANNER_MODE=legacy` in the release env file and confirm it with the preflight check before tagging. The planner override endpoint requires authentication, so the release env file also needs the planner override token on the next line.

env line for kahof-fajeg: ARCHIVE_KEY3=397

Ticket: staging env misconfigured for the Halverton partner SFTP drop. The uploader is pointing at the retired host, so nightly manifests from Brightquay never land. Fix is to update SFTP_HOST to the new endpoint and redeploy before Friday's release cut. Note the env file is also missing its final line, which must set the credential the uploader presents.

secret setting of yajog-taguf: ARCHIVE_KEY3=051

# Resolvix dev env — context for review
# We hit intermittent NXDOMAIN responses from the internal resolver when
# pods churn quickly, so DNS_RETRY_COUNT is raised to 5 and
# DNS_CACHE_TTL pinned at 30s as a mitigation. Do not lower these until
# the resolver fix lands. The fallback resolver requires an auth
# credential, appended on the next line.

sealed setting: VAULT_KEY20=c8ea1e419912889df6b4

# Supplier Renewal: Dellmark Fabrication (Managers Only)

Quick rundown for sales leads: our contract with Dellmark Fabrication, who supply casings for the Orwick line, is up in March. They're asking for a 7% increase; we're countering with a longer term and volume commitments. Quality's been solid, so nobody wants a switch. Don't hint at any of this to customers yet. The confidential note below explains why.

confidential, yajof-fadug: Project Julvan slips by one quarter because of the audit delay.